From e37485c7885d7ee299431072745bcf75953fcc94 Mon Sep 17 00:00:00 2001 From: mertmit Date: Sat, 1 Oct 2022 00:34:12 +0300 Subject: [PATCH] fix(at-import): escape single quote for select options Signed-off-by: mertmit --- packages/nocodb/src/lib/meta/api/sync/helpers/job.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/packages/nocodb/src/lib/meta/api/sync/helpers/job.ts b/packages/nocodb/src/lib/meta/api/sync/helpers/job.ts index f6d8890ce8..29c7d14954 100644 --- a/packages/nocodb/src/lib/meta/api/sync/helpers/job.ts +++ b/packages/nocodb/src/lib/meta/api/sync/helpers/job.ts @@ -579,7 +579,7 @@ export default async ( }; // if options are empty, configure '' as default option ncCol.dtxp = - colOptions.data.map((el) => `'${el.title}'`).join(',') || "''"; + colOptions.data.map((el) => `'${el.title.replace(/'/gi, "''")}'`).join(',') || "''"; break; case undefined: break;